Questions & Answers
Q: Why is measuring sea level a complex task?
Measuring sea level is complex due to factors such as tides, lunar and solar cycles, changing coastlines, land movements, and gravitational anomalies. All these elements create fluctuating patterns that need to be accounted for.
Q: How do scientists measure sea level from space?
Scientists use satellites with radar to measure sea level from space. The radar measures how long light takes to bounce off the water's surface, providing accurate measurements of sea level.
Q: How do changing coastlines affect sea level measurements?
Changing coastlines make sea level measurements challenging as land can rise or sink over long periods. The shape and location of coastlines constantly shift, leading to variations in sea levels in different regions.
Q: How does climate change affect sea level?
Climate change affects sea level differently in different places. Melting glaciers redistribute mass, causing the water level around them to drop initially. Additionally, the melting of ice shifts the Earth's mass and affects its rotation, further impacting sea levels.
